O lekcji
Praca z plikami jest ważnym elementem w wielu aplikacjach webowych i systemach. W zależności od języka programowania, dostępne są różne metody umożliwiające otwieranie, czytanie, zapisywanie i zamykanie plików.
Czytanie pliku
W PHP można odczytać plik za pomocą funkcji takich jak fopen()
, file_get_contents()
, lub fread()
.
Przykład odczytu pliku w PHP:
<?php
// Odczyt pliku za pomocą file_get_contents()
$file_content = file_get_contents('example.txt');
echo $file_content;
?>
Przykład odczytu pliku za pomocą fopen() i fread():
<?php
// Otwórz plik do odczytu
$file = fopen("example.txt", "r");
if ($file) {
// Odczytaj zawartość pliku
$content = fread($file, filesize("example.txt"));
echo $content;
// Zamknij plik po odczycie
fclose($file);
} else {
echo "Nie udało się otworzyć pliku!";
}
?>
Zapisywanie pliku
Aby zapisać dane do pliku, w PHP używamy funkcji takich jak fwrite()
, file_put_contents()
, lub fopen()
w trybie zapisu (w
, a
).
Przykład zapisu do pliku za pomocą file_put_contents()
:
<?php
$data = "To jest przykładowa zawartość do zapisu!";
file_put_contents("example.txt", $data);
echo "Dane zostały zapisane do pliku.";
?>
Przykład zapisu do pliku za pomocą fopen()
i fwrite()
:
<?php
$file = fopen("example.txt", "w");
if ($file) {
$data = "To jest przykładowa zawartość do zapisu!";
fwrite($file, $data);
fclose($file);
echo "Dane zostały zapisane do pliku.";
} else {
echo "Nie udało się otworzyć pliku!";
}
?>